 I was in Cle Elum today and stopped at 3 forks reloading supply. the inventory they have is really surprising. I bought an 8 pound jug of sr4759, and they had many other hard to find items in stock. lots of powder, primers, just about anything you need for reloading. just a heads up incase you need some item you haven't been able to find. they do have a web page you can Google it. argie1891
